RUTLAND – Joanne O. (Navickas) Kosla, 89, of Main Street, died on Friday, February 16, 2007, at the Worcester Medical Center, Worcester after an illness.
Her husband, Leslie A. Kosla, Sr., died in 1975. She leaves two sons, Leslie A. Kosla, Jr., of Larkspur, CA and William G. Kosla of Edgartown, MA; a daughter, Dolores A. Mero of Vero Beach, FL; five grandchildren and three great grandchildren. A brother, Alphonse Navickas and a sister, Angela Vaisa, predeceased her. She was born in Worcester, the daughter of the late William and Anna (Simonis) Navickas.
Joanne devoted her time to her family and community, after retiring from Astra Pharmaceutical Company in Worcester. She did volunteer work at the former Rutland Heights Hospital, the Mustard Seed and Fallon Clinic. She visited Haiti as a member of St. Patrick’s Church Mission Society.
